Output 74d1ff2b939621e580a84e4201188d60a92b28cf5294ea36fd1336076fd1c48e:11

value
15763113
script pubkey
OP_0 OP_PUSHBYTES_20 66640c34baa59cb911e984f3f8f33d81b4faba72
address
bc1qvejqcd965kwtjy0fsnel3ueasx604wnje89pzp
transaction
74d1ff2b939621e580a84e4201188d60a92b28cf5294ea36fd1336076fd1c48e
spent
true